Most nonprofits track time in Excel, paper logs, or nothing at all. This is because every “real” HR tool is priced and designed for corporations. CrossHR’s edge is radical simplicity at a price that actually fits a 10-person org with 2 volunteers.

Separate timesheets for paid staff and volunteers, with different approval flows and reporting. Most tools don’t distinguish between them.
Nonprofit – exclusive win
Tag hours to specific grants or different funding sources. Nonprofits live and die by grant reporting — this feature alone is worth the subscription.
Nonprofit – exclusive win
Manager gets a simple email or in-app notification. One click approves. No login required for basic approvals. Designed for busy directors.
Removes the #1 friction
Flag when an employee is approaching set overtime thresholds by state. Visual warning before the payroll run, not after.
Compliance protection
Let orgs upload their existing spreadsheets and auto-map columns. The biggest barrier to switching is migration. Make it zero effort.
Kills adoption barrier
Simple accrual rules, balance visibility for employees, and manager approval. Replaces the sticky note on the whiteboard.
Used daily by everyone
One place for offer letters, I-9s, performance notes, and certifications. Replaces the physical folder in someone’s desk drawer.
Replaces paper chaos
Certifications, driver’s licenses, food handler cards — automatically alert HR when something is about to expire. Critical for nonprofits with service workers.
Prevents liability
Auto-generate from employee data. Useful for board reports, grant applications, and new hire onboarding.No Visio required.
Grant reporting gold
Customizable onboarding tasks with status tracking. Assign to HR, manager, or the new hire themselves. Never forget the I-9 again.
Standardizes process
Send handbook updates or policy changes. Track who has signed and who hasn’t. Built-in audit trail for compliance.
Legal protection
Simple, lightweight notes from 1-on-1s or reviews. Not a full performance system — just a dated record that protects you if things go sideways.
